drybox are available at alot of places if im not wrong. i live in amk area. gotch MS colour sell.. fairprice XTRA also got sell. for drybox. dont leave ur gear inside with sillica gel for too long .. must take out use once in awhile. cause if its too dry inside. will cause the rubber grips to dry and spoil from what ive heard as it is too dry. u can also go HOME FIX buy hygrometer to measure the humidity loh~ |
